Importance of Strong, Unique Passwords

In today’s digital age, the importance of strong, unique passwords just can't be overstated. We’re constantly hearing about data breaches and cyber-attacks affecting millions of people worldwide. And yet, many folks still use weak or common passwords like "123456" or "password". Seriously? It's hard to believe!

First off, let's talk about why a strong password is so crucial. A robust password acts as your first line of defense against unauthorized access to your accounts. Receive the scoop view that. If someone cracks it, they could potentially get into your email, social media profiles, and even online banking accounts. I mean, who wants that kind of trouble?

Now you might think creating a unique password for every account is overkill. But hey, it's not! Using the same password across multiple sites is pretty much asking for trouble. Think about it: if one site gets hacked and you’ve reused passwords elsewhere, then boom – hackers have access to all those other accounts too.

What makes a good strong password anyway? It should be at least 12 characters long (the more the better), include upper and lower case letters, numbers, and special symbols. Avoid using easily guessable info like birthdays or pet names – they're not as secret as you think! Oh boy, remembering all these complex passwords sounds impossible though doesn't it? That's where password managers come in handy; they store all your different passwords securely so you don’t have to memorize each one.

It's also important to change your passwords regularly – although I know it can be such a hassle sometimes! Regular updates can help prevent unauthorized access especially if an old password has been compromised without your knowledge.

But let’s face it: no system is foolproof. Even with strong and unique passwords hackers may find ways around them through phishing attacks or other means. That’s why multi-factor authentication (MFA) adds another vital layer of security by requiring something besides just the password - usually a code sent via text message or generated by an app.

So there you have it: while creating strong unique passwords might seem tedious at times it's actually one of simplest yet most effective cybersecurity practices out there! Don’t wait until after you've been hacked to take action; start securing yourself today because prevention really is better than cure in this case!

Utilizing Two-Factor Authentication (2FA) in Cybersecurity Practices

In today's digital age, cybersecurity practices are more important than ever. One of the key strategies that's been gaining traction is utilizing two-factor authentication, or 2FA for short. Now, you might think that adding another layer of security sounds complicated and annoying, but it's really not as bad as it seems.

First off, let's get into what 2FA actually is. It's a method that requires not just one, but two different types of credentials to verify your identity when you're logging into an account. Typically, you'd enter your password first—y'know, the one you keep forgetting and have to reset every few months. But then, instead of being done, you'll get prompted to enter a second piece of info. This could be a code sent to your phone or even a fingerprint scan if you're fancy like that.

So why bother with this extra step? Well, passwords aren't enough anymore. They're just too easy to crack with all the tech-savvy hackers out there. Imagine someone guessing your dog's name combined with your birth year—bam, they're in! But with 2FA? Even if they've got your password somehow, they still need that second piece of information.

Now don't get me wrong; no system is foolproof. You might be thinking: "If they're so great why isn't everyone using them?" Good question! Some folks find it inconvenient and believe it's unnecessary for their accounts. Others simply don't know how much at risk they truly are until something terrible happens.

But here's the kicker—using 2FA can drastically reduce those risks without causing too much hassle in most cases. Think about it: would you rather spend an extra 10 seconds getting a text message code or spend hours dealing with hacked accounts and lost data? The choice seems pretty clear once you put it like that.

Yet some people will argue against its effectiveness by pointing out instances where even 2FA has failed due to sophisticated phishing attacks or SIM-swapping scams—and yes—those do exist! However these scenarios are relatively rare compared to basic password breaches which happen way more frequently.

Recognizing and Avoiding Phishing Scams

In today's digital age, recognizing and avoiding phishing scams has become a crucial skill for anyone using the internet. Phishing scams are attempts by cybercriminals to trick you into giving away your personal information like passwords, credit card numbers, or other sensitive data. It’s kinda scary how sophisticated these scams have become, so staying vigilant is super important.

First off, let's talk about what phishing actually looks like. You might get an email that seems legit—maybe it claims to be from your bank or a popular online store. The message will often urge you to click a link and enter your details. But don't do it! These links usually lead to fake websites designed to capture your information.

One way to spot a phishing scam is by checking the sender's email address. Often, it won't match the company it's supposedly from. Also, look out for generic greetings like "Dear Customer" instead of using your real name. And if there are spelling mistakes or odd grammar in the email? That's another red flag right there.

Now, I'm not saying all suspicious emails are easy to spot—some can be really convincing. So what should you do if you're unsure? Well, don’t click on any links or download attachments from questionable emails! Instead, go directly to the company's website yourself by typing their URL into your browser.

Another thing that's worth mentioning is multi-factor authentication (MFA). Even if someone does get ahold of your password through a phishing scam, they’d still need another piece of information—like a code sent to your phone—to access your account. It's not foolproof but hey, every little bit helps!

Oh! And let’s not forget about those sneaky phone calls and text messages either—they're just as dangerous! If someone calls claiming they're from tech support and needs remote access to fix an issue on your computer? Hang up immediately! Legit companies won’t ask for access outta nowhere.

And seriously folks—keep your software updated! Those updates aren't just annoying—they patch security vulnerabilities that scammers love exploiting.

To wrap this up: always question unexpected requests for personal info; double-check URLs before entering sensitive data; enable MFA wherever possible; keep everything updated—and you'll be less likely fall victim to these nasty schemes.

Regular Software Updates and Patching

Regular Software Updates and Patching

In today's fast-paced digital world, regular software updates and patching ain't just some fancy tech talk; they're crucial for cybersecurity. You'd think everyone would be on board with this by now, but nope, that's not always the case. Some people still don't see the importance of keeping their software up-to-date. It's kinda baffling if you ask me.

So why are these updates so darn essential? Well, let's break it down. Software developers are constantly working to improve their products. They find bugs, vulnerabilities, and other nasty stuff that hackers could exploit. When they release updates or patches, they're basically saying, "Hey, we fixed something important! Please install this!" Ignoring these updates is like leaving your front door wide open; you're practically inviting trouble.

But oh boy, managing all those updates can feel overwhelming sometimes! I mean, who has time to keep track of every single piece of software on their computer or network? And don't get me started on those annoying update notifications popping up at the worst possible moments. It’s tempting to just click "remind me later" and move on with your day.

Yet here's the kicker: delaying or ignoring updates can lead to serious consequences. Cybercriminals are always on the lookout for outdated systems to exploit. Remember WannaCry ransomware attack in 2017? That was a wake-up call for many organizations worldwide about the dangers of neglecting updates. So yeah, it's not just about improving performance or adding cool new features; it's about protecting sensitive data and maintaining trust.

Now let’s talk about patch management – a term that often gets thrown around in cybersecurity circles but isn't really understood by everyone. Patch management involves identifying which patches are needed, testing them out (’cause you don’t wanna apply an update that breaks everything), and then deploying them across systems efficiently. Sounds simple enough right? But reality check: it takes effort and resources.

Organizations need a solid plan in place for handling updates and patches effectively without causing disruption to daily operations. Automated tools can help streamline this process but relying solely on automation ain’t gonna cut it either – human oversight is necessary too!

Safe Browsing Habits and Secure Websites

In today's digital age, it's impossible to ignore the importance of safe browsing habits and secure websites. After all, our lives are intertwined with the internet more than ever before. But how many of us actually take cybersecurity seriously? Probably not as many as you'd think.

So, let's dive into what it means to have safe browsing habits. First and foremost, don't click on suspicious links or download attachments from unknown sources. It might sound obvious but you'd be surprised how many people fall for phishing scams every day! It's not just about avoiding sketchy emails either; even ads on reputable sites can sometimes be malicious.

Using strong, unique passwords for different accounts is another crucial habit. I've seen folks using "password123" or their birthdate across multiple platforms—big mistake! If one account gets compromised, then hackers can access everything else too. And please, enable two-factor authentication whenever possible. It’s an extra step that could save you a lotta trouble down the line.

Now let's talk about secure websites. You'd think it's easy to tell which ones are safe and which aren't, right? Wrong! Not all websites are created equal when it comes to security. Always look for "https://" in the URL rather than just "http://". That little 's' stands for 'secure' and indicates that any data sent between your browser and the website is encrypted.

But hey, don’t think just cause a site has HTTPS that it’s totally foolproof either. Cybercriminals can still create fake secure sites to trick you into providing personal information. So keep an eye out for other trust indicators like a padlock icon in the address bar or security certifications from well-known authorities.

One thing that's often overlooked is keeping software up-to-date—browsers included! Developers regularly release patches to fix vulnerabilities that hackers love exploiting. So if you're ignoring those update notifications thinking they're annoying or time-consuming… bad call!

In conclusion, practicing good browsing habits and knowing how to identify secure websites ain't rocket science but requires some vigilance and common sense. The internet's full of risks but also wonderful opportunities; don't let negligence turn those opportunities into regrets!

Managing Privacy Settings on Social Media
Managing Privacy Settings on Social Media

Managing privacy settings on social media is a crucial part of cybersecurity practices that we often overlook. I mean, who doesn't like to share their latest vacation pics or rant about their day? But, let's be real, not managing your privacy settings can lead to some serious issues.

First off, it's not just about keeping nosy people out of your business. It's also about protecting yourself from cybercriminals who could use your information for malicious purposes. You wouldn't want someone stealing your identity or hacking into your accounts, right? So, take some time to review and adjust those settings.

Most platforms give you options to control who sees what – friends, followers, or the public. Don’t assume that default settings have got you covered because they usually don't prioritize your privacy. It’s worth diving into those menus and toggling off things that make you uncomfortable.

Also, it's important not to forget about location settings. Social media loves tracking where you are but sharing your location can actually put you at risk. Turn it off unless it's absolutely necessary; honestly, no one needs to know you're grabbing coffee at the corner cafe every morning.

Moreover, think twice before linking apps with your social media accounts. Sure, logging in with Facebook makes things easier but it also means giving more apps access to your personal data. The fewer connections you have between services, the safer you'll be.

And oh boy! Don't neglect regular updates—settings and policies change all the time so keeping up-to-date is essential. A setting that's private today might become public tomorrow after an update if you're not careful.

In conclusion (without being repetitive), managing privacy settings isn't something we should ignore or procrastinate on doing later cause our online safety depends on it! So go ahead and tweak those settings – better safe than sorry!

Encrypting Sensitive Information

Encrypting sensitive information is a cornerstone in the realm of cybersecurity practices. In today's digital age, where data breaches and cyberattacks are becoming more frequent, it's essential to understand what encryption actually entails and why it matters.

First off, let's get one thing straight: encryption ain't as complicated as it sounds. At its core, it's just about converting readable data into an unreadable format so that only authorized parties can make sense of it. Imagine you've got a secret message you wanna send to a friend. You don't want anyone else to read it, right? So, you use some sort of code that only your friend knows how to decode. That's basically what encryption does for your sensitive information.

Now, why should we bother with encrypting our data anyway? Well, think about all the personal information floating around online—credit card numbers, social security details, medical records—you name it. If this info falls into the wrong hands, the consequences could be disastrous. Identity theft isn't just a scare tactic; it's a real threat that affects millions of people every year.

So here's where encryption comes into play—it acts like a lock on your digital front door. Without the decryption key (which only authorized users have), any intercepted data remains gibberish to prying eyes. But hey! It's not foolproof. No system is entirely impenetrable; hackers are always finding new ways to break through defenses. Yet still, encrypted data presents much tougher nuts for them to crack compared to plain text.

Moreover—and oh boy—let's not forget compliance regulations! Many industries have strict rules regarding how sensitive information must be protected. For example, the Health Insurance Portability and Accountability Act (HIPAA) requires healthcare providers to implement measures ensuring patient confidentiality—including encryption of electronic health records.

But hold up! Don’t think once you’ve encrypted your files you can rest easy forevermore either! Encryption protocols themselves need regular updates 'cause cyber threats evolve constantly too.

In conclusion (if there has gotta be one), encrypting sensitive information isn't merely an option anymore; it's practically mandatory if you're serious about safeguarding valuable data from unauthorized access or thefts alike . While no method guarantees absolute security , leveraging strong encryption techniques certainly fortifies overall defense mechanisms against potential breaches .
